Our guide will meet you at your hotel or airport and drive you the Sultanahmet area. First visit will be Topkapi Palace which was one of the famous residence of the Ottoman sultans. You will learn more about the history of Ottomans.
you will visit the reaches Hagia Sophia built in 532 AD by Roman Emperor Justinian I.
You will visit the Blue Mosque, has its fame from its beautiful blue Iznik tiles.
You will visit Grand Bazaar where is one of the largest and oldest covered markets in the world, with more than 58 covered streets and over 1,200 shops which attract between 250,000 and 400,000 visitors daily. Opened in 1461,
you will drive to Derinkuyu Underground City, one of the best preserved and deepest underground cities in Cappadocia. Derinkuyu is 55 meters deep and has 8 levels open to visitors.
Goreme Panorama where you will have a complete view of Goreme valley and Goreme village: fairy chimneys, rock formations and cave houses. You will be also given the general information about Cappadocia.
Ihlara Valley which is a 16 km long canyon and both sides are lined with rock carved churches. You will have a 3km hike and visit one of the cave churches in Ihlara Valley.
you will visit Selime Monastery, carved out of the rock by Christian monks in the 13th century. The size of the church makes a visit here astonishing.
you will drive to the Goreme Open Air Museum where you can see the world’s most important Byzantine cave churches. Goreme Open Air Museum is listed as one of the UNESCO World Heritage Sites.

You will end the day at Uchisar Castle, which is the highest point of Cappadocia and the view from the top is just brilliant.
You will drive to Bulbul mountain where the House of the Virgin Mary is located in a nature park between Ephesus and Selcuk, which is believed to be the last residence of the Virgin Mary, mother of Jesus.
ou will continue and enter the Ephesus Ancient City and pass by the Magnesia gate. The guided walking tour will take you through one of the most magnificent excavations in the world. See the Odeon, the Fountain of Trajan, the steam baths of Scholastika, the temple of Hadrian and the impressive library of Celsius. The library is adorned with columns and statues. The next stop is The Grand Theater, where St. Paul preached, is the largest theater in antiquity with a capacity of 24,000 seats.
the ruins of the Temple of Artemis was built during the Archaic period, the temple is one of the Seven Wonders of Ancient World

you will drive to the National Park of Pamukkale. You will see the Necropolis (cemetery) of Hierapolis which is one of the biggest ancient cemeteries in Anatolia with 1.200 graves, Roman Bath, Domitian Gate, and the Main Street, Byzantium Gate
you walk to the natural warm water terraces which were formed by running warm water that contains calcium. The temperature of the water is about 35. You can see the gleaming white travertine terraces of Pamukkale, located next to the ruins of Hierapolis. The extraordinary effect is created when water from the hot springs loses carbon dioxide as it flows down the slopes, leaving deposits of limestone.
